Leesha Procida
Caption: Leesha Procida
Actress Source: IMDB Leesha Procida is an actress, known for Smosh (2006) and Mark at the Movies (2009).
Sarah Farooqui pictures →
John J. Schafer pictures →
Kelly Rutherford pictures →